Serena Maneesh: "I Just Want To See Your Face"

Serena-Maneesh, disappearing for five years into their neo-shoegaze haze, have finally emerged with a few new tracks from their upcoming album, ambitiously titled S-M 2: Abyss In B Minor. Recently joining the eclectic 4AD roster, the band has decided to expand their sound slightly, letting previously buried pop elements come up for air.

First we have "Ayisha Abyss," a track that genuinely swings, moving quickly along the dark atmosphere it creates through whispered vocals, heavy percussion, and pulsating, effect-heavy guitars. Now we have the appropriately titled "I Just Want To See Your Face," a faster, angrier track, but this time with the female vocals more present in the mix. For the true distortion-heads, the feedback is still there -- it's just not dominating the rest of the group.The songs, for this reason, are less derivative, and are able to display elements that may have seemed muddy in the past.

So far, it's a good sign. For a band that was close to be left behind, they're doing a great job at building excitement for their new album.
